Job Summary

Responsible for the execution and support of quality programs and oversight of daily quality assurance activities supporting Clinical Research, Medical Affairs, and Pharmacovigilance activities, Regulatory submissions, and other regulated activities related to compliance with federal regulations and company standards for Stamford operations in Purdue Pharma L.P.

Principle Responsibilities

  • Participate in the development and execution of a comprehensive annual Good Clinical Practices, Good Laboratory Practices, Pharmacovigilance, and Risk Evaluation and Mitigation Strategy ("GCP / GLP / PV / REMS") audit plan covering internal processes, vendor services and clinical site activities.
  • Lead / manage the execution of defined audits utilizing internal / external resources in a cost efficient and effective manner. Ensure post-audit activities entail timely follow-up and resolutions.
  • Serve as GCP / GLP / PV / REMS subject matter expert on teams. Assure that studies / programs are complete and meet internal standards and regulatory requirements :
  • Ensure overall compliance, identify compliance gaps and ensure they are mitigated in a timely manner.
  • Ensure project timeline accurately captures all quality activities.
  • Review plans and materials for compliance, and contracts / proposals to ensure they adequately capture outsourced QA requirements.
  • Lead continuous improvement and remediation for areas identified by audit / inspection and CI team initiatives.
  • Collaborate with senior management and relevant stakeholders on corrective actions resulting from audits and regulatory inspections. Lead / manage efforts for verification of necessary completed corrective and preventative actions ensuring that compliance risks are satisfied.
  • Internal Customers primarily include Drug Safety and Pharmacovigilance, Clinical Research and Development, Toxicology, Regulatory Affairs, Medical Affairs departments. Collaborate and support ad-hoc projects that enhance the overall compliance of the Company.
  • Ensure pharmacovigilance activities including safety information processing and reporting follow regulations.
  • Lead multiple key host roles for regulatory inspections and post inspection follow up and corrective action implementation.
  • Lead / manage the quality support role for all post marketing studies, (including epidemiology, non-interventional studies, abuse deterrent studies) to ensure they are conducted in accordance with regulatory and company standards.
  • Remain current on regulatory expectations and best practices through constant monitoring of changes to regulations, guidance documents, and industry trends related to clinical; safety and regulatory reporting.
  • Perform other assigned responsibilities as required.

Education and Experience Requirements

Sr Quality Specialist II must have :

BS required and 8 years minimum experience, or equivalent level of experience in pharmaceutical or related industries; or graduate degree (MS preferred) with 6-10 plus years' experience or PhD with 3-6 plus years' experience.

Necessary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

The Sr. Quality Specialist II must demonstrate :

  • Five years of Safety / GCP experience.
  • Proficiency in understanding regulatory documents and the drug submission process.
  • Proficiency in assessing data to ensure compliance with applicable GxP regulations and internal SOPs.
  • Current knowledge base within relevant technical discipline of FDA regulations and awareness of the necessity and impact of compliance on the business.
  • Effective interpersonal, verbal, and listening skills. Knowledge of and adherence to appropriate laws and regulations is critical. Proficient in MS Office software and applications
  • The ability to anticipate challenges and drive full understanding of problems faced within the team.
  • The ability to drive the analysis and change management process for how we solve problems and reach the goal.
  • The ability to think broadly about the causes of problems, their impact, and their solutions.
  • The ability to implement solutions and controls to prevent future problems and uses experience and awareness to identify problems early.
